Police on Tuesday arrested a foreign worker on suspicion she abused an elderly woman from Rishon Lezion.
The abuse was exposed on a hidden camera installed by the 96-year-old victim's grandson.
The suspect has been caring for the elderly woman for the past four years.

The victim's family recently noticed something unusual about her behavior, finding her flinching at the sight of other people.
This led the woman's grandson to install a hidden camera in her house.
Footage from the camera soon confirmed the family's suspicion that she was being abused and showed the caretaker shaking the woman, throwing a blanket over her and even hitting her.
The family took the footage to the police who proceeded to arrest the suspect. The caretaker admitted to the allegations.
An indictment will be filed against her with the Rishon Lezion Magistrate's Court on Wednesday.
Police noted that the suspect expressed remorse.
